The Growing Importance of Digital Zakat

In recent years, the concept of digital Zakat has gained significant traction, particularly in Southeast Asia. Countries like Indonesia are witnessing a surge in online platforms that facilitate charitable donations, enabling users to fulfill their Zakat obligations conveniently. However, with this growth comes the pressing need for robust security measures to protect sensitive information and funds.

AI: A Game Changer for Fraud Detection

Artificial Intelligence (AI) is revolutionizing how organizations protect themselves against fraud in digital Zakat transactions. Machine learning algorithms analyze patterns and detect anomalies, allowing services to flag suspicious activities in real-time. This proactive approach not only prevents potential losses but also enhances user confidence in digital donation platforms.

Biometrics: Strengthening User Identity Verification

As the reliance on digital Zakat grows, so does the necessity for secure identity verification. Biometric systems, such as fingerprint and facial recognition technologies, offer a reliable means of confirming user identities. This measure is crucial for preventing identity theft and ensuring that donations reach the intended recipients.

Benefits of Biometric Authentication

Incorporating biometric verification in Zakat platforms provides numerous advantages:

  • Streamlined user experience by eliminating passwords.
  • Higher security compared to traditional methods.
  • Increased accuracy in distinguishing genuine users from impostors.

Impacts on the Indonesian Market

The Indonesian market is at the forefront of adopting digital Zakat solutions. With over 270 million people, Indonesia represents a significant opportunity for technology-driven charitable efforts. As platforms evolve, so do the expectations of users demanding more secure and efficient means of managing their Zakat contributions.

Emerging Trends in Online Zakat Platforms

Recent trends in the Indonesian online Zakat market include:

  • The rise of mobile applications that integrate AI and biometric features.
  • Increased collaboration among tech companies and charitable organizations.
  • Growing awareness of the importance of digital security among users.
